Introduction: Strengthening MDF Production Capacity
The Yıldız Sunta MDF Dryer Plant Project is a strategic investment in medium-density fiberboard (MDF) production infrastructure. MDF has become a cornerstone of the furniture, construction, and interior design industries, and efficient drying systems are essential for ensuring product quality, durability, and sustainability.
KDT Industry contributed to this project by delivering structural steel frameworks, drying system infrastructure, storage tanks, and piping systems, ensuring the facility’s efficiency, safety, and compliance with global wood-processing standards.
Project Scope and Objectives
The project aimed to modernize MDF production by installing advanced drying facilities. KDT Industry’s objectives included:
- Designing and fabricating structural steel frameworks for dryer halls and auxiliary units.
- Manufacturing tanks and silos for water, resins, and process chemicals.
- Delivering piping systems for hot air, steam, and process water.
- Constructing platforms, pipe racks, and walkways for safe and efficient operations.
- Ensuring compliance with EN, ISO, and international MDF plant standards.

Challenges and Solutions
The MDF Dryer Plant project involved several engineering challenges:
- High Heat and Moisture Levels – Required reinforced piping and structural systems.
- Fiber Abrasion – MDF fibers are abrasive, demanding wear-resistant materials.
- Continuous Operations – Plant designed for non-stop production cycles.
- Environmental Standards – Strict regulations on emissions and energy use.
KDT Industry’s Solutions:
- Used heat-resistant steels for drying and piping systems.
- Applied abrasion-resistant linings in ducts, tanks, and conveyors.
- Installed prefabricated modular steel units for faster assembly.
- Integrated energy-efficient drying technology reducing operational costs.
